How Emerging Leaders Works:
Emerging Leaders is a FREE executive-level training program that provides tools and resources to help small companies sustain and grow. Now in its ninth year, Emerging Leaders is an intensive entrepreneurship education series for small businesses that have the potential for quick growth and job creation. The initiative has been a change-maker in increasing opportunities, providing participating businesses with an organizational framework, as well as a resource network that helps to form sustainable companies and promote economic development.
Sessions are held bi-weekly on Tuesday evenings from 5pm – 8pm at Rutgers Business School in Newark. Participants commit approximately 40 hours of in-class time, divided over 13 in-person sessions. Participants will also spend at least 20 hours over the course of the curriculum in self-directed CEO mentoring groups. All instructional in-class sessions, CEO Mentoring Groups and session preparation are interconnected and of equal importance. In total, each participant can expect to commit approximately 100 hours to analyzing their business and planning for growth.

If you are a small business owner interested in applying for the 2017 training cycle, be sure to first learn more about the full eligibility requirements for participants:
Qualified Businesses Must Have:
- $400k – $10M in gross annual revenues
- One full-time employee besides the owner
- Been in business for at least 3 years
